No magic solution to cope with low milk prices
Therefore, the focus must be on putting the farm in the best possible position to deal with a volatile price, while availing of tools and mechanisms to stabilise price.
It must be recognised that most dairy farmers will this year experience a cash deficit, when they combine cash generated from the dairy farm with their drawings and tax.
